And we are back… for now. Another International Break does loom but we are safe for a few weeks.

GW4 begins with Saints v Man Utd at 12.30pm. That may be the 1st manager of the season done and dusted.

Brighton v Ipswich, Palace v Leicester, Fulham v West Ham, Liverpool v Forest and Man City v Brentford all follow at 3pm.

Villa and Everton are at 5.30pm, before a rare Saturday night treat with Bournemouth v Chelsea at 8pm.

Spurs and Arsenal have the early slot on Sunday at 2pm, due to drunkeness and misbehaviour possibilities.

Wolves and Newcastle are trusted to behave better at 4.30pm.
